There is no true PDF Export in Illustrator, because Illustrator allows to have editable PDFs with .ai-content stored within. Other apps does not allow that, and some users heavily rely on editable PDFs.
Attemps to solve this were made, but there is no clear solution so far. Still we hope to find one.
The intended way to get a PDF (without loosing your data) at the moment would be to use Save a Copy command that saves a separate copy of your file to PDF instead of Save As which keeps a saved file open.
